Output 51d71d6439f7ce95e76ccd01f4cf58e6b0c615607a382669919aa2de1edd4abb:4

value
1880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c1b5519969c464408d7984a221ee9339b9c18ae OP_EQUAL
address
3D1ETRMR72yKC4rL2kMyGrbTk1sRyJVAq8
transaction
51d71d6439f7ce95e76ccd01f4cf58e6b0c615607a382669919aa2de1edd4abb
spent
true